/**
* Replace every `currentColor` occurrence in the SVG with the given color.
* Pure: no filesystem access, so it is straightforward to unit-test.
*/
export function colorizeFaviconSvg(
svg: string,
lightColor: string,
darkColor: string
): ColorizedFavicon {
return {
light: svg.replaceAll(CURRENT_COLOR, lightColor),
dark: svg.replaceAll(CURRENT_COLOR, darkColor)
};
}
/**
* Shrink the inner SVG content uniformly and re-center it so `padding` (a
* 0..1 fraction) is reserved as equal margin on each side. Returns the input
* unchanged for non-positive padding, missing/invalid `viewBox`, or unexpected
* markup so the caller always gets a renderable SVG.
*/
export function padFaviconSvg(svg: string, padding: number): string {
if (!(padding > 0) || padding >= 1) return svg;
const viewBoxMatch = svg.match(/viewBox\s*=\s*["']([^"']+)["']/i);
if (!viewBoxMatch) return svg;
const parts = viewBoxMatch[1]
.trim()
.split(/[\s,]+/)
.map(Number);
if (parts.length !== 4 || parts.some((n) => !Number.isFinite(n))) return svg;
const [, , width, height] = parts;
if (width <= 0 || height <= 0) return svg;
const scale = 1 - padding;
const translateX = (padding * width) / 2;
const translateY = (padding * height) / 2;
const openTagStart = svg.search(/<svg\b/i);
if (openTagStart === -1) return svg;
const openTagEnd = svg.indexOf('>', openTagStart);
if (openTagEnd === -1) return svg;
const closeStart = svg.lastIndexOf('</svg');
if (closeStart === -1 || closeStart <= openTagEnd) return svg;
const openTag = svg.slice(0, openTagEnd + 1);
const inner = svg.slice(openTagEnd + 1, closeStart);
const closeTag = svg.slice(closeStart);
const group = `<g transform="translate(${translateX} ${translateY}) scale(${scale})">`;
return `${openTag}${group}${inner}</g>${closeTag}`;
}
